Are Bananas Herbs?
While the banana plant is colloquially called a banana tree, it’s actually an herb distantly related to ginger, since the plant has a succulent tree stem, instead of a wood one. The yellow thing you peel and eat is, in fact, a fruit because it contains the seeds of the plant. Why is a banana […]

When Should You Add Herbs To Cooking?
When to Add: Herbs may be added near the end of cooking for more distinct flavor, or at the beginning for more blended flavors. Ground spices and herbs release their flavors readily. Which Herbs Go Well Together?
For example: Basil, probably the most popular of fresh herbs, combines well with bay, garlic, marjoram, oregano, savory and thyme in cooked dishes. Chives go well with basil, chervil, cilantro, cress, dill, lemon balm, marjoram, nasturtium, oregano, parsley, sorrel, tarragon and thyme. What herbs go together? How Do You Cook With Dried Herbs?
In general, use 1/4 – 1/2 of dried herbs per serving. To release flavour, dried herbs are best rehydrated. Add either at the beginning of cooking, or about 20 minutes before the end. How Do You Cook With Herbs?
Use whole herbs at the beginning of cooking – like bay leaves – because it takes longer to draw out the flavour when they are whole. When chopped, the cells of the herb leaves are broken open, which lets out the aroma. Chopped herbs are best used before serving. How can herbs be used in […]
Can You Revive Dead Herbs?
To revive dying herbs, cut back and diseased roots back to healthy growth with a sterile pair of pruners. Wipe the blades with disinfectant after every cut to prevent spreading fungal pathogens and replant the herb in a new pot with new soil and locate the plant in partial sun whilst it recovers. Can You Plant Herbs In Regular Potting Soil?
Growing Herbs in Pots and Planters Start with good-quality potting soil, which ensures good drainage. Do not use ordinary garden soil, which does not drain well when used in a container.
